Whitehat SEO Rules: SEO Ranking Report

1. Perform Keyword Research – First up is to perform keyword research to identify high-volume and relevant terms to your business. Doing so will allow you to create more targeted content that will be more easily found by potential customers – resulting in more traffic and more sales.

2. Monitor Competitor Websites – Part of SEO ranking reports is to monitor how well your website and other competitors are performing on Google. This will allow you to identify areas of opportunity and broaden your understanding of what other businesses are doing in terms of SEO.

3. Analyze Your Content – To maximize SEO efforts, analyzing your website’s content to see what’s ranking well and what can be improved on is essential. This will ensure that the content on each page is relevant and engaging, making sure that readers are taking action.

4. Track Your Progress – Having the ability to see the hard data on how your website is performing is key. Tracking the progress of your SEO efforts will allow you to not only illustrate the ROI of your SEO initiative, but also identify any optimization opportunities you may have missed.

5. Learn What Works – Knowing which SEO strategies to apply to your pages is essential, but it’s equally important to learn what works and what doesn’t for your website. Obtaining a SEO ranking report will quickly identify problem areas, and help you refine your SEO efforts over time.

When it comes to optimizing your pest control business’s website, creating an actionable SEO ranking report is essential. Following these five tips will ensure that you have the necessary data and insights required to maximize organic search traffic, and ultimately increase your leads and sales.
